**Handover — Reception, Aldermoss Building**

Hi Petra, a few notes before my leave. The quiet room on the top floor (Room 12A) is now reception-managed: visitors may use it only if escorted, and it must be checked at 17:30 for belongings and lights. The blinds stick, so pull them gently. Sanna from facilities collects the signage on Fridays. The door was rekeyed on Monday, so the old code no longer works. The new one is:

turnstile pass: bdg-QZV-3

Subject: Appointment reminder job — heads up

Welcome aboard. The Larkmead clinic reminder job runs nightly at 02:00 and sends next-day appointment notices. It skipped one batch last night due to a queue hiccup; we replayed it manually this morning, no patient impact. Playbook is on the Fernhollow wiki. For audit purposes, the replayed run carries the token shown below.

trace token, fafog-kageg: htk4_98e6

## v4.2 — Default sharding changes

For the sync: the Mosswick profile store is now sharded by default on user ID, eight shards out of the gate instead of the old single-shard setup. New deployments get this automatically; existing clusters need the migration job from last sprint. Reads fan out transparently, writes route by hash. Hot-shard alerts are wired into Gullwatch already. The shard router ships with these defaults, which you should skim before Thursday.

deployment values, kajep-kageg:
[praix]
host = praix.paliqcorp.corp
user = praix_svc
database = praix_prod